Ever thought of playing Modern Warfare for free?! Well, you can do that now! Activision is allowing the general public access to certain (but not all) of the multiplayer modes in Modern Warfare 2. But there’s a catch! You only have one week.

Activision isn’t making the whole MW2 multiplayer package for whatever reason. Only these 12 modes will be available:

  • Gunfight
  • Grind
  • Domination
  • Ground War
  • One in the Chamber
  • Invasion
  • Gun Game
  • Hardpoint
  • Kill Confirmed
  • Infected
  • Team Deathmatch
  • All or Nothing

The free Modern Warfare 2’s free week begins Wednesday (April 19) at 10 a.m. PT, 1 p.m. ET, and 6 p.m. BST and runs until April 26 at the same time. You should definitely set aside around 125 or so of gigabytes of space (the game’s suggested space needs on Steam.

All mentioned modes above are 6v6, with the exception of Gunfight, which is a 2v2 mode. Invasion and Ground War are much larger, with tens of players on each side. It does imply, though, that if you use the trial time, you won’t have access to modes like Search and Destroy and Free For All.

For players with free access, those modes are dispersed among 10 maps, which you can check out below:

  • 6v6 maps: Farm 18, Shoot House, Shipment, Dome, Himmelmat Expo, Pelayo’s Lighthouse
  • Ground War/Invasion map: Santa Seña
  • Gunfight maps: Alley, Blacksite, Exhibit, Shipment
